    Dricus Du Plessis Height, The South African Champion Standing Tall in UFC History

    Like his moniker “Stillknocks,” Dricus Du Plessis’s height has become an integral part of who he is. His height of six feet places him squarely on the middleweight division’s dividing line; he is neither as tall as Alex Pereira or Israel Adesanya nor as short as Robert Whittaker. His body is remarkably comparable to that of an all-purpose tool; it is long enough to maintain range with a 76-inch reach, yet it is compact enough for explosive bursts. This combination has proven to be incredibly effective throughout his career.

    Dricus Du Plessis – Key Information

    AttributeDetails
    Full NameDricus Du Plessis
    NicknameStillknocks
    Date of Birth14 January 1994
    BirthplaceWelkom, Free State, South Africa
    NationalitySouth African
    Height6 ft 0 in (1.83 m)
    Weight185 lb (84 kg)
    Reach76 in (193 cm)
    StanceOrthodox
    DivisionMiddleweight (current), former Welterweight
    TeamTeam CIT MMA
    TrainerMorne Visser
    Rank2nd degree black belt in kickboxing
    Years Active2013–present
    UFC RecordFormer UFC Middleweight Champion
    Other TitlesFormer EFC Welterweight & Middleweight Champion, Former KSW Welterweight Champion

    Du Plessis demonstrated that his physique and unrelenting speed could defeat a disciplined, jab-heavy approach when he defeated Sean Strickland at UFC 297. He kept up pressure for five vicious rounds by using his stamina and fortitude, and his six-foot size helped him stay grounded during intense fights. His triumph, which became him the first South African UFC champion, proved that, when used consistently, resolve is more important than size.

    It was even more evident when defending against Israel Adesanya at UFC 305. Du Plessis continued to close distance, upsetting rhythm, and ultimately securing a face crank submission in round four, despite Adesanya’s apparent advantage represented by his greater height and reach. It was blatantly obvious that he could manage scrambles and generate leverage against even the most technically skilled strikers thanks to his physique.

    Du Plessis appeared to have much improved in his rematch with Sean Strickland at UFC 312. His entries became more planned, his pressure more measured. Strickland found it difficult to interpret his variable angles because of his six-foot size, which allowed him to switch between head movement and level adjustments with ease. Winning by a unanimous vote demonstrated his ability to change and grow under duress thanks to his physical type and mental resilience.

    Even after losing to Khamzat Chimaev at UFC 319, Du Plessis’s reputation was mentioned. Du Plessis’s explosiveness was somewhat mitigated by Chimaev’s stifling grappling technique, but his tenacity was still incredibly dependable, seeing him through five rounds against an unbeaten opponent.     His story is made more complex by his own tenacity. Prior to surgery in 2023, Du Plessis competed for years on a nasal oxygen intake of just 8%, demonstrating remarkable durability. His ability to withstand hardship was demonstrated even by non-traditional training techniques, including as his instructor Morne Visser’s contentious taser discipline.
